Friday The 13th Los Angeles PremiereMarcus Nispel has been slated to direct the Nu Image/Millennium Films remake of “Conan the Barbarian,” according to Variety.

The long awaited project will end a nine-year development escapade to reboot the Robert E. Howard-created character that was portrayed on the big screen by Arnold Schwarzenegger in 1982.

Production is scheduled to begin later this year in South Africa and Bulgaria.  Lionsgate will share production of the film with Nu Image/Millennium.  Avi Lerner, Joe Gatta and Fredrick Malmberg will produce.

The script is penned by Thomas Dean Donnelly and Joshua Oppenheimer, whose credits also include “Sahara” and “Cowboys and Aliens.”

The Wachowski brothers, Robert Rodriguez, and Brett Ratner were all considered to helm the project but the former two declined, and Rattner failed to commit in a timely fashion opening the door for Nispel who also was responsible for the remakes of “The Texas Chainsaw Massacre” and “Friday the 13th.”
